What Makes Asphalt Surfaces Last

Making an asphalt surface durable involves more than simply pouring material. It starts with careful planning and preparation. The ground beneath the asphalt, often called the sub-base, must be properly prepared and made firm. This foundation supports the entire structure above it. The quality of the asphalt mix itself is also very important. It must be chosen to fit the expected traffic and weather conditions of the area. Finally, the paving process must be done correctly, with the asphalt laid at the right thickness and pressed down firmly to remove air pockets. Each of these steps plays a vital role in how long the surface will last.

Site Evaluation and Preparation

Before any asphalt is laid, the area goes through a thorough preparation. This important stage involves several steps to create a stable and suitable base for the new pavement.

  1. The existing surface material is carefully taken out to the correct depth.
  2. The ground is shaped to create proper drainage, moving water away from the paved area.
  3. Any soft or unstable soil is dug out and replaced with good, packed-down fill material.
  4. Points where utilities enter the ground and nearby structures are kept safe during the work.

Building a Strong Base Layer

After the site is prepared, a strong base layer is put in. This layer provides the main support and helps spread the weight of traffic evenly across the ground underneath. This prevents cracks and dips.

  1. Usually, crushed rock material is used for this base.
  2. This material is spread evenly and pressed down in layers to make it as dense as possible.
  3. The right amount of moisture is kept during this pressing down to make sure it is very strong.
  4. The thickness of this base layer is decided by how much traffic is expected and the condition of the ground.

Precision Spreading

The asphalt mix itself is a carefully made blend of stones, sand, and a sticky binder, sometimes with other materials added. It must be spread evenly and quickly to make sure it sticks together well and has a smooth finish.

  1. Hot asphalt mix, brought to the site at exact temperatures, is spread using special paving machines.
  2. The paver controls how thick and wide the asphalt layer is, making sure it spreads evenly.
  3. Experienced teams watch the paving work to fix any uneven parts right away.
  4. Overlaps between paving passes are carefully managed to make the joints smooth and unnoticeable.

Critical Compaction

Pressing down the asphalt, known as compaction, is perhaps the most important step in the whole process. It makes the material dense, taking out air pockets and making the pavement stronger and better at keeping water out.

  1. Heavy rollers are driven over the fresh asphalt many times, right after it is laid.
  2. Different types of rollers (like those that vibrate or use rubber tires) are used one after another to get the best density.
  3. The temperature range for pressing down is watched carefully to stop the fresh asphalt from cracking or tearing.
  4. Good compaction leads to a smoother surface and makes the pavement last much longer.

Preventing Common Issues

Good maintenance plays a very important role in keeping asphalt strong. Damage can be stopped through steady attention and fixing things at the right time.

  1. Crack Sealing: Small cracks are sealed quickly to stop water from getting in. Water can cause big damage during times when it freezes and thaws.
  2. Sealcoating: A protective layer is put on every few years to guard against the sun's rays, chemicals, and water, keeping the asphalt flexible.
  3. Drainage Management: Making sure water flows away properly stops it from sitting in puddles. Standing water can wear away the asphalt base over time.
  4. Regular Cleaning: Trash and spills are removed to stop the asphalt from breaking down and to keep it looking clean.

Qualities of a Reliable Contractor

For those looking for asphalt paving services near me, it is important to check several things. Quality professional asphalt paving services are known for being open and having a history of successful work.

  1. Check for proper licenses and full insurance.
  2. Ask for references from past clients and contact them to hear about their experiences.
  3. Look at pictures or examples of projects they have finished.
  4. Get detailed, written price estimates that clearly explain the work, materials, and total cost.
  5. Confirm their experience with projects similar to yours to make sure they have the exact skills needed.
